Below I will introduce to you the method of making rice noodle rolls. After reading this, you must try to make it yourself. 1. Ingredients: rice noodle rolls, hard tofu, celery, marinated meat slices: soy sauce, oyster sauce, salt, chicken powder, starch. 2.1 Add the marinated minced meat. 3.2 Heat the pan, add oil, cut the tofu into cubes and stir-fry until browned. 4.1 Chop the coriander and add it. 5.2 Stir-fry the tofu and minced meat until fragrant. 6.1 Spread out the rice noodle rolls. 7.2 Fry until the water is absorbed and set aside. 8. Sprinkle the filling evenly on the dough. 9.Roll the rice noodle roll back to its original shape. 10.Roll it up. 11. Finished product picture@@It is soft and delicious.
